Code entschlüsseln?
Hey, wie kann man folgenden Text übersetzen?
Wivu uvi Srld jkvyk ze Evn Yzcctivjk
5 Antworten
Am einfachsten sind Verschiebe- oder Ersetzungs-Chiffren zu entschlüsseln.
Bei Verschiebe-Chiffren (auch Cäsar Verschlüsselung genannt) wird jeder Buchstabe um x Zeichen im Alphabet verschoben.
Beispiel für x=2
Text abcde...xyz
Code cdefg...zab
Ein anderes bekanntes Beispiel ist rot13.
Allerdings ist dieses Chiffre nicht besonders komplex, da nur 25 Codes möglich sind (bei x=26 wird aus a wieder a, dh Klartext und Code sind identisch)
Ersetzungs-Chiffren sind etwas komplexer, da keine Zusammenhänge zwischen den Buchstaben bestehen. Die Code-Tabelle sieht dann zB so aus
Text abcde...xyz
Code uxgjw...afo
Hier gibt es schon wesentlich mehr Möglichkeiten (konkret 25! = ~15,5×40²⁴). Einfaches Ausprobieren ist also nicht erfolgversprechend.
Beide Verschlüsselungstechniken haben aber eine Schwachstelle: Die Häufigkeitsanalyse.
Buchstaben wie E oder N treten häufiger auf als Q oder Y.
Diese Häufigkeit wendet man dann auf den verschlüsselten Text an.
In deinem Beispiel:
wivu uvi srld jkvyk ze evn yzcctivjk
ergibt sich folgende Häufigkeit
c d e i j k l r s t u v w y z
2 1 2 3 2 3 1 1 1 1 2 5 1 2 2
v kommt am häufigsten vor und E ist der häufigste Buchstabe der deutschen Sprache, also ersetze ich v durch E
wiEu uEi srld jkEyk ze eEn yzcctiEjk
Jetzt kann ich sehr einfach prüfen, ob ein Cäsar-Chiffre vorliegt: Von v zu E sind es 9 Verschiebungen. Wende ich dieses Schema auf den restlichen Text an, erhalte ich:
FRED DER BAUM STEHT IN NEW HILLCREST.
Das ist eine Caesar Verschlüsselung. Dafür gibt es Seiten, wo man das entschlüsseln kann.
Fred der Baum steht in New Hillcrest
MIICIjANBgkqhkiG9w0BAQEFAAOCAg8AMIICCgKCAgEA6CwB0Y6cGfiS1lP6wBNqSlwtGV09bPWrvQUAvN6/PX0gvyKF0GJYOk1qYwc+ZSxKnsjTRBrANlzW5IU8MNXZC6TMEa6V+6niswnAHy+H9nGXlN6lfP9WLjlk/90cjokZfuVFNDZ1t4W+C5SAxZ1wmBlJiYE1W3YqsEuWZGVfkfjn+vvgW5YlOUkvCdy2tnP8wNa1FPLjkh1f5YeqsPUgw9jVGJGpSus0FWemnd5yazck+8DpeDgZsqa83zZcjZV2GPB2Ig3nHKPIWy+Ulj9vkNwSvxHnMSMkk04+1R7K8i+a8VhrhC6gyz3I9cZzPQsdhC0ZbTnV+gDEp1BcwD/whV+pM+5rULaD5CuOqQPS0c/bwhOxp06SsUy7m0emxGnKvK7lVe5ukLHzLR6x79/E5upVwk7HrhoCeWRfmN8pcsv7SxVlnOLiFj+BoPLkmHvjtM0FFlfUMobya44tOmf2LS/0rtxtkMAJ5mJJxgvu36AJnnHFi86So9nNZcYnFYXmoMZmhFSuqUvMZJRWpksjRRZs6rPKa7zwRwC4QgQ/G0gPM3k9v9V87lYMI+cIci9QtWOvkAqHfx3x+HxI7udOx6F2Lk985eM0bZjCKFzzu1pBjQf7fHP2U0rQkc8ENIzODlBUm6wiMNuSO3VfA6BT5SEpCpSMsvXNQJYP1jI6rRUCAwEAAQ==
Kannst du das bitte machen?
Er ist ein bisschen kurz, um damit was machen zu können.
Ansonsten kannst mal schauen, was der häufigste Buchstabe ist, vielleicht klappt dann das Cäsar-Verfahren, siehe Wikipedia.
Ist eine rot17 Verschlüsselung.
Entschlüsselt steht da
Fred der Baum steht in New Hillcrest
wie kann man folgenden Text übersetzen?
Ohne Kenntnis der Verschlüsslung gar nicht.